Overview
Gavilan College in Gilroy, California is a 2-year California public community college with an enrollment of approximately 4,500 students, most of whom are enrolled part-time. The enrollment is approximately 48 percent Hispanic and 48 percent Caucasian. The target area, Census Tract 5136.01 in the City of Gilroy, is 80 percent low- to moderate-income Hispanic, about 35 percent of whom were born outside the United States.

It is within this area that Gavilan College will create a Neighborhood Education and Technology Center. The project will renovate an existing 7,200-square-foot "old school shop" building adjacent to the new Gilroy Unified School District (GUSD) neighborhood resource center portable buildings. This new complex will provide space for adult education classes, a community technology center, and a permanent location for two programs--the Regional Occupational Program (ROP) and the "Mujeres Pueden" (Women Can) job-training program.
